In this chapter, for the convenience of exposition, we remind some basic notions of stochastic calculus and mathematical statistics. It is supposed that the reader is familiar with stochastic calculus; therefore, the properties of the stochastic integral, the likelihood ratio formula, and limit theorems are given without proofs. The definitions and properties of some estimators of the parameters are given in more detail because they are less well-known. The Kalman–Bucy filter is provided with the proof due to the importance of this result for the problems considered in this work. At the end, some lower bounds on the mean-squared risks are presented and the possibility of the construction of a lower bound in the problem of adaptive filtering is discussed.
